About this experience

This is a day trip to Lake Kerkini, one of the 10 most valuable wetland habitats in Greece with about 300 species of birds and rare animals. Among the many species, admire the beautiful flamingos and the magnificent buffalos. All these are combined with the wonderful view of Mount Beles and the majestic valley of Serres.

You depart to Kerkini Lake by bus at 8:00 AM. You reach the Dam of Kerkini Lake (Lithotopos area) and enjoy bird watching through the lake. The area for horse riding is situated next to the dam and you can enjoy a horse ride as long as the weather permits it.

Next, you have a hot cup of coffee and afterwards you make a stop at the farm, just some kilometers away, wihere the impressive buffalos will walk near to you. Later on, you move a bit further to Vironia village and enjoy your lunch in a traditional Greek tavern. You depart to Thessaloniki at about 2:00 PM taking the perimeter road of the west side of the lake.

Detailed itinerary

1

The distance is 98km and lasts approximately 1½ hour.

We reach the dam of the picturesque Kerkini Lake in the area of Lithotopos. Each season of the year the lake hosts different species of birds, therefore every visit hides a different surprise for the traveler. The beautiful flamingos though, can be found there all year round and their characteristic pink plumage colors the blue surface of the lake giving enchanting views combined with the verdant surrounding landscape. The horse riding area is located next to the dam where we can enjoy a ride and feel part of this wonderful natural scenery (optional and upon notification).

Later on, we have a coffee break and then continue our trip to the east part of the lake, visiting a traditional farm with impressive buffalos that walk next to us; observing their movements in their natural environment and learning their unique history.

About Thessaloniki

Thessaloniki is Greece's second-largest city and a vibrant cultural hub with a rich history dating back to ancient times. Known for its Byzantine monuments, Ottoman architecture, and lively food scene, it offers a unique blend of old and new.
